Q: What are the signs of stress and anxiety and anxiety in men?

A: Symptoms of stress and anxiety in men may include restlessness, irritability, difficulty concentrating, muscle tension, and sleep disruptions. Signs of depression in men may consist of consistent unhappiness, loss of interest in activities, tiredness, modifications in cravings or weight, feelings of insignificance or guilt, and thoughts of death or suicide.

Q: Is stress and anxiety a mental illness?

A: Yes, stress and anxiety is a psychological health condition defined by excessive worry or worry that can disrupt daily life.

Q: How can I understand if I have anxiety?

A: If you experience relentless worry or fear that affects your day-to-day functioning, it is advisable to consult with a mental health expert who can examine your symptoms and offer a precise diagnosis.

Q: How can I deal with anxiety?

A: Coping techniques for anxiety may consist of practicing relaxation methods, participating in regular exercise, looking for support from enjoyed ones, and participating in treatment sessions to discover efficient coping skills.

Q: What causes depression in men?

A: Anxiety can be caused by a combination of genetic, biological, ecological, and psychological factors. It is important to seek expert aid to identify the underlying triggers specific to an individual's situation.

Q: How can I assist somebody with anxiety and depression?

A: Offer support by listening without judgment, encouraging them to look for professional aid, and providing details about offered resources. Prevent minimizing their experiences or providing simple solutions.
